What rollover terms mean for your real cash
Wagering requirements are the most critical—and often confusing—element of any casino bonus offer, essentially dictating how many times you must play through your bonus funds before you can withdraw any winnings. Understanding wagering requirements means looking beyond the initial bonus hype to the fine print, where terms like 30x or 40x multipliers directly impact your potential payout. For example, a £100 bonus with a 30x requirement demands you wager £3,000 before cashing out. To master these rules, keep these key points in mind:
- Game contributions: Slots typically count 100%, while table games like blackjack may only count 10–20%.
- Time limits: Most bonuses must be cleared within 7–30 days or you forfeit the funds.
- Max bet caps: Exceeding a £5–£10 bet per spin can void your bonus entirely.
Always calculate the total playthrough required—a 40x requirement on a £50 bonus means £2,000 in bets—and prioritize low-wagering offers to maximize your real-money chances. Ultimately, a clear grasp of these terms separates savvy players from costly mistakes.

Game Contribution Rates: What Counts Toward Wagering
Game contribution rates determine what percentage of each wager counts toward meeting a casino bonus’s wagering requirement. Slot games typically contribute 100%, meaning every dollar bet fully satisfies the requirement. Table games like blackjack or roulette often contribute less, sometimes only 10% or 20%, due to their lower house edge. Live dealer games may contribute even less or be excluded entirely. Slots are generally the safest choice for efficient wagering, as their high contribution rate maximizes progress. Always check a bonus’s terms, as low-contribution games can significantly extend the time needed to clear a playthrough requirement. Understanding these rates helps players strategize and avoid unnecessary losses while meeting bonus conditions.

Live dealer and pokie weighting explained
When diving into online casino bonuses, not every spin or bet you make actually chips away at your wagering requirements. Each game has a specific game contribution rate, which dictates what percentage of your bet counts toward the playthrough. Slots usually contribute 100%, meaning every dollar you wager goes fully toward the target. Table games like blackjack or roulette often contribute only 10–20%, while live dealer games might count as little as 5–10%. This is why a big slot win can meet your wagering goal faster than playing poker or baccarat.
The key takeaway: always check the terms—a game with low contribution can make your wagering requirement feel ten times bigger.
Here’s a quick look at common contribution rates:
- Slots (most) – 100%
- Video Poker – 5–20%
- Blackjack / Roulette – 10–20%
- Live Dealer Games – 5–10%
- Baccarat – 5–15%
Some special casinos even exclude certain games entirely (0% contribution), so reading the fine print saves you from wasted bets and frustration.

Expected return calculations are the backbone of any realistic value assessment, helping you cut through the hype and see what an investment might actually pay off. The goal is simple: estimate the average gain you can expect over time, considering all possible outcomes. You typically do this by multiplying each potential return by its probability and then adding those numbers together. For example, a stock might have a 30% chance of gaining 10%, a 50% chance of gaining 5%, and a 20% chance of losing 2%. Your expected return would be (0.30 × 10%) + (0.50 × 5%) + (0.20 × -2%) = 5.1%. This method forces you to be honest about risks and rewards. A realistic value assessment depends on using solid probability estimates, not wishful thinking, to guide smarter decisions.
